When it comes to sealing solutions in industrial applications, PTFE gaskets are a popular choice due to their excellent characteristics and performance PTFE, or polytetrafluoroethylene, is a synthetic fluoropolymer that is known for its high chemical resistance, temperature resistance, and low friction properties PTFE gaskets are widely used in various industries such as chemical processing, food and beverage, pharmaceutical, and oil and gas due to their reliability and durability.
PTFE gaskets are designed to create a tight seal between two or more surfaces to prevent leakage of fluids or gases They are commonly used in applications where other materials may fail due to their exceptional properties One of the key advantages of PTFE gaskets is their resistance to a wide range of chemicals, including acids, bases, solvents, and oils This makes them ideal for use in corrosive environments where other materials would deteriorate quickly.
Another important characteristic of PTFE gaskets is their high temperature resistance PTFE can withstand temperatures ranging from -200°C to 260°C, making it suitable for use in both cryogenic and high-temperature applications This temperature resistance allows PTFE gaskets to maintain their performance even in extreme conditions, ensuring long-term reliability and efficiency.
In addition to their chemical and temperature resistance, PTFE gaskets also offer low friction properties This makes them ideal for use in applications where minimizing friction or wear is important, such as in pumps, valves, and other mechanical systems The low friction properties of PTFE gaskets help improve the efficiency and performance of equipment while reducing maintenance and downtime.
PTFE gaskets are available in a variety of shapes and sizes to suit different sealing requirements They can be custom-made to fit specific dimensions or standardized to meet industry standards Common types of PTFE gaskets include full-face gaskets, ring gaskets, envelope gaskets, and flat gaskets, each designed for different sealing applications ptfe gaskets. The choice of gasket type will depend on factors such as pressure, temperature, and chemical compatibility.
When installing PTFE gaskets, it is important to follow proper procedures to ensure a secure and reliable seal This includes cleaning and preparing the surfaces to be sealed, selecting the appropriate gasket type and size, and tightening the bolts or fasteners to the specified torque Proper installation is essential to prevent leaks and ensure the gasket performs optimally over time.
